當前位置:首頁 » 編程軟體 » 功能圖法編程

功能圖法編程

發布時間: 2022-06-20 19:31:39

1. S7—200系列PLC的順序功能圖與順序設計法與FX2N狀態流程圖與狀態編程法的區別在什麼地方

編程的本質都是一樣的。具體區別的話您去注意下西門子和三菱的說明書,上面的一些特殊指令有點區別。貌似位移取反那些就不一樣吧。記得不是特別清楚了。其實稍稍注意下影響也不怎麼大。最後祝您生活愉快。

2. 功能圖法借鑒於什麼方法

1.方法簡介 一個程序的功能說明通常由動態說明和靜態說明組成.動態說明描述了輸入數據的次序或轉移的次序.靜態說明描述了輸入條件與輸出條件之間的對應關系.對於較復雜的程序,由於存在大量的組合情況,因此,僅用靜態說明...
2.實戰演習

3. 什麼是plc的功能塊圖編程

一般來講,功能塊,就是將一個plc程序中頻繁使用到代碼,封裝起來,以便每次的調用。你這里所說的調用功能塊,就是將其實例化了啊。通常編寫好功能塊以後,到你要使用功能塊的程序中,插入功能塊,就行了,各家plc開發平台的調用方法都相近。調用之後,你只需要給調用的功能塊配置好輸入參數和輸出參數,就可以了。比如,你做了一個加法的功能塊,把兩個數相加,然後結果得到一個數,調用的時候,就是給輸入兩個地址區比如說歐姆龍的d0,d1,然後輸出給一個地址區比如d3,這樣,程序運行的時候,你給d0和d1送數,就能得到結果,放在d3中了。

4. 共同探討下使用三菱PlC的SFC順序功能圖的編程心得

梯形圖比較簡單,直觀,但是對於初學者來說調試的時候比較麻煩;
用STL編程的話思路比較清晰,好調試。。
用SFC的話比較理解力需要強一些,但是用的人比較少,注意事項比較多。。

5. PLC順序功能圖編程原則是先什麼後什麼

先是安全條件,後是執行條件是原則。
PLC的用戶程序,是設計人員根據控制系統的工藝控制要求,通過PLC編程語言的編制規范,按照實際需要使用的功能來設計的。只要用戶能夠掌握某種標准編程語言,就能夠使用PLC在控制系統中,實現各種自動化控制功能。
根據國際電工委員會制定的工業控制編程語言標准(IEC1131-3),PLC有五種標准編程語言:梯形圖語言(LD)、指令表語言(IL)、功能模塊語言(FBD)、順序功能流程圖語言(SFC)、結構化文本語言(ST)。這五標准編程語言,十分簡單易學。
梯形圖語言(LD)
梯形圖語言是PLC程序設計中最常用的編程語言。它是與繼電器線路類似的一種編程語言。由於電氣設計人員對繼電器控制較為熟悉,因此,梯形圖編程語言得到了廣泛的歡迎和應用。
梯形圖編程語言的特點是:與電氣操作原理圖相對應,具有直觀性和對應性;與原有繼電器控制相一致,電氣設計人員易於掌握。
梯形圖編程語言與原有的繼電器控制的不同點是,梯形圖中的能流不是實際意義的電流,內部的繼電器也不是實際存在的繼電器,應用時,需要與原有繼電器控制的概念區別對待。
指令表語言(IL)
指令表編程語言是與匯編語言類似的一種助記符編程語言,和匯編語言一樣由操作碼和操作數組成。在無計算機的情況下,適合採用PLC手持編程器對用戶程序進行編制。同時,指令表編程語言與梯形圖編程語言圖一一對應,在PLC編程軟體下可以相互轉換。圖3就是與圖2PLC梯形圖對應的指令表。
指令表表編程語言的特點是:採用助記符來表示操作功能,具有容易記憶,便於掌握;在手持編程器的鍵盤上採用助記符表示,便於操作,可在無計算機的場合進行編程設計;與梯形圖有一一對應關系。其特點與梯形圖語言基本一致。
功能模塊圖語言(FBD)
功能模塊圖語言是與數字邏輯電路類似的一種PLC編程語言。採用功能模塊圖的形式來表示模塊所具有的功能,不同的功能模塊有不同的功能。
功能模塊圖編程語言的特點:功能模塊圖程序設計語言的特點是:以功能模塊為單位,分析理解控制方案簡單容易;功能模塊是用圖形的形式表達功能,直觀性強,對於具有數字邏輯電路基礎的設計人員很容易掌握的編程;對規模大、控制邏輯關系復雜的控制系統,由於功能模塊圖能夠清楚表達功能關系,使編程調試時間大大減少。
順序功能流程圖語言(SFC)
順序功能流程圖語言是為了滿足順序邏輯控制而設計的編程語言。編程時將順序流程動作的過程分成步和轉換條件,根據轉移條件對控制系統的功能流程順序進行分配,一步一步的按照順序動作。每一步代表一個控制功能任務,用方框表示。在方框內含有用於完成相應控制功能任務的梯形圖邏輯。這種編程語言使程序結構清晰,易於閱讀及維護,大大減輕編程的工作量,縮短編程和調試時間。用於系統的規模校大,程序關系較復雜的場合。圖5是一個簡單的功能流程編程語言的示意圖。
順序功能流程圖編程語言的特點:以功能為主線,按照功能流程的順序分配,條理清楚,便於對用戶程序理解;避免梯形圖或其他語言不能順序動作的缺陷,同時也避免了用梯形圖語言對順序動作編程時,由於機械互鎖造成用戶程序結構復雜、難以理解的缺陷;用戶程序掃描時間也大大縮短。
結構化文本語言(ST)
結構化文本語言是用結構化的描述文本來描述程序的一種編程語言。它是類似於高級語言的一種編程語言。在大中型的PLC系統中,常採用結構化文本來描述控制系統中各個變數的關系。主要用於其他編程語言較難實現的用戶程序編制。
結構化文本編程語言採用計算機的描述方式來描述系統中各種變數之間的各種運算關系,完成所需的功能或操作。大多數PLC製造商採用的結構化文本編程語言與BASIC語言、PASCAL語言或C語言等高級語言相類似,但為了應用方便,在語句的表達方法及語句的種類等方面都進行了簡化。
結構化文本編程語言的特點:採用高級語言進行編程,可以完成較復雜的控制運算;需要有一定的計算機高級語言的知識和編程技巧,對工程設計人員要求較高。直觀性和操作性較差。

6. 求PLC的編程方法

最常用的是梯形圖法、指令表法、順序功能圖法

7. 哪位工控高手能講解一下三菱PLC 用順序功能圖 編程方法啊

編程手冊不是寫得挺清楚了,自己按說明做些小系統慢慢研究吧,別人教的總不如自己學的,具體不懂的再拿出來問,我想這樣學會更好。

8. 西門子 s7-200 編程指令輸入及順序功能圖編寫

方法一:下載s7-200的幫助文檔,在中間的指令幫助裡面查找。
方法二:在micro/win編程界面,把左邊的指令拖動到右邊任意一個網路中(如果指令已經在網路中可以跳過這一步),然後點擊上面菜單欄的幫助,選擇「這是什麼」(按shift+f1亦可),滑鼠變成問號後,點擊下面需要求助的指令,就可以彈出相關幫助。
方法二目前只能適用於xp和win7,win8以上由於微軟的help組件有問題無法適用。

9. PLC提供的編程語言簡介

PLC的編程語言與一般計算機語言相比具有明顯的特點,它既不同於一般高級語言,也不同於一般匯編語言,它既要易於編寫又要易於調試。目前,還沒有一種對各廠家產品都能兼容的編程語言。目前,
PLC為用戶提供了多種編程語言,以適應編制用戶程序的需要,
PLC提供的編程語言通常有以下幾種:梯形圖、指令表、順序功能圖和功能塊圖1、梯形圖
梯形圖編程語言是從繼電器控制系統原理圖的基礎上演變而來的。
PLC的梯形圖與繼電器控制系統梯形圖的基本思想是一致的,但是在使用符號和表達式等方面有一定區別。
梯形圖具有形象、直觀、簡單明了,易於理解的特點,特別適合開關量邏輯控制,是PLC最基本、最普遍的編程語言。2、語句表(STL)
語句表是用助記符來表達PLC的各種功能。它類似計算機的匯編語言,但比匯編語言通俗易懂,也是較為廣泛應用的一種編程語言。使用語句表編程時,編程設備簡單,邏輯緊湊、系統化,連接范圍不受限制,但比較抽象。一般可以與梯形圖互相轉化,互為補充。目前,大多數PLC都有語句表編程功能。3、順序功能圖(SFC)
順序功能圖編程是一種圖形化的編程方法,亦稱功能圖。它的編程方式採用畫工藝流程圖的方法編程,只要在每個工藝方框的輸入和輸出端,標上特定的符號即可。採用順序功能圖編程,可以使具有並發、選擇等復雜結構的系統控製程序大為簡化。許多PLC都提供了用於SFC編程的指令,它是一種效果顯著、深受歡迎的編程語言,目前國際電工委員會(IEC)也正在實施並發展這種語言的編程標准。4、功能塊圖(FBD)
邏輯功能圖是一種由邏輯功能符號組成的功能塊來表達命令的圖形語言,這種編程語言基本上沿用了半導體邏輯電路的邏輯方塊圖。對每一種功能都使用一個運算方塊,其運算功能由方塊內的符號確定。對於熟悉邏輯電路和具有邏輯代數基礎的人員來說,使用非常方便。

熱點內容
滑鼠如何編程 發布:2025-05-16 02:29:09 瀏覽:815
安卓70能用什麼軟體 發布:2025-05-16 01:45:09 瀏覽:480
編程發展史 發布:2025-05-16 01:38:52 瀏覽:528
android圖片氣泡 發布:2025-05-16 01:38:40 瀏覽:885
文件加密編輯器下載 發布:2025-05-16 01:30:41 瀏覽:343
linuxapacheyum安裝 發布:2025-05-16 01:30:31 瀏覽:476
大連賓利浴池wifi密碼是多少 發布:2025-05-16 01:25:36 瀏覽:172
緩存數據生產服務 發布:2025-05-16 01:08:58 瀏覽:585
普通電腦伺服器圖片 發布:2025-05-16 01:04:02 瀏覽:971
伺服器地址和埠如何區分 發布:2025-05-16 01:03:17 瀏覽:834